The purpose of this act is to provide a budget procedure for emergency medical service districts which shall: 1. Establish uniform and sound fiscal procedures for the preparation, adoption, execution and control of budgets; 2. Enable districts to make financial plans for both current and capital expenditures and to ensure that their directors administer their respective functions in accordance with adopted budgets; 3. Make available to the public and investors sufficient information as to the financial conditions, requirements and expectations of the district; and 4. Assist districts to improve and implement generally accepted accounting principles as applied to governmental accounting, auditing and financial reporting and standards of governmental finance management.
